Joseph Francis 1848 - 1922

(13 December 1848 – 8 November 1922)

Funeral services will be held at 1:30 o’clock Wednesday afternoon at the Church of the Nazarene for Joseph Francis, 83 years old, resident of Woodbury County 66 years, who died Sunday in his home at 5061 Orleans Avenue.

Rev. J.M. Jones, pastor of the church, will officiate and burial will be in Graceland Park Cemetery under the direction of W. Harry Christy Funeral Home.

Mr. Frances was born in England and came to the United States with his parents when he was 4 years old. He came to Woodbury County in 1865. He had lived in Sioux City several years.

Miss Olive Miller and Mr. Frances were married August 6, 1871, in Oto, Iowa. Frances was a member of the Church of the Nazarene.

The deceased man is survived by 13 children, five of whom are daughters.

They are: Mrs. M.E. Ringrose of Des Moines, Mrs. E.G.Ganoe, of Sloan, Iowa, Mrs. R.L. Arnold of Hornick, Iowa, Mrs. Olive Jackson of Oto and Mrs. Ruth Bowers of Smithland. Eight sons also survive him. They are George of Kettle Falls, Wash., C.J. of Sebeka, Minn., of Sioux City, S.J. of Oto, L.H. and Leonard both of Climbing Hill, Lawrence of Sioux City and Hobart Francis of Hornick. Forty-four grandchildren and 16 great-grandchildren also are included among the survivors.
